Learning tvOS effectively takes a structured approach, whether you're starting as a beginner or aiming to improve your existing skills. Here are key steps to guide you through the learning process:

  • Understand the basics: Start with the fundamentals of tvOS. You can find free courses and tutorials online that cater specifically to beginners. These resources make it easy for you to grasp the core concepts and basic syntax of tvOS, laying a solid foundation for further growth.
  • Practice regularly: Hands-on practice is crucial. Work on small projects or coding exercises that challenge you to apply what you've learned. This practical experience strengthens your knowledge and builds your coding skills.
  • Seek expert guidance: Connect with experienced tvOS tutors on Codementor for one-on-one mentorship. Our mentors offer personalized support, helping you troubleshoot problems, review your code, and navigate more complex topics as your skills develop.
  • Join online communities: Engage with other learners and professionals in tvOS through forums and online communities. This engagement offers support, new learning resources, and insights into industry practices.
  • Build real-world projects: Apply your tvOS skills to real-world projects. This could be anything from developing a simple app to contributing to open source projects. Using tvOS in practical applications not only boosts your learning but also builds your portfolio, which is crucial for career advancement.
  • Stay updated: Since tvOS is continually evolving, staying informed about the latest developments and advanced features is essential. Follow relevant blogs, subscribe to newsletters, and participate in workshops to keep your skills up-to-date and relevant.

The time it takes to learn tvOS depends greatly on several factors, including your prior experience, the complexity of the language or tech stack, and how much time you dedicate to learning. Here’s a general framework to help you set realistic expectations:

  • Beginner level: If you are starting from scratch, getting comfortable with the basics of tvOS typically takes about 3 to 6 months. During this period, you'll learn the fundamental concepts and begin applying them in simple projects.
  • Intermediate level: Advancing to an intermediate level can take an additional 6 to 12 months. At this stage, you should be working on more complex projects and deepening your understanding of tvOS’s more advanced features and best practices.
  • Advanced level: Achieving proficiency or an advanced level of skill in tvOS generally requires at least 2 years of consistent practice and learning. This includes mastering sophisticated aspects of tvOS, contributing to major projects, and possibly specializing in specific areas within tvOS.
  • Continuous learning: Technology evolves rapidly, and ongoing learning is essential to maintain and improve your skills in tvOS. Engaging with new developments, tools, and methodologies in tvOS is a continuous process throughout your career.

Setting personal learning goals and maintaining a regular learning schedule are crucial. Consider leveraging resources like Codementor to access personalized mentorship and expert guidance, which can accelerate your learning process and help you tackle specific challenges more efficiently.
